Origin: The name Spencer has English origins and is derived from the occupational surname meaning a steward or dispenser of provisions, or someone who oversees the activities of a household.
Famous Personalities: Some notable individuals with the name Spencer include:
1. Spencer Tracy - A legendary American film actor, known for his roles in classic films such as "Guess Who's Coming to Dinner" and "Inherit the Wind."
2. Spencer Pratt - An American television personality known primarily for his appearance on the reality show "The Hills."
3. Spencer Boldman - An American actor, best known for his role as Adam Davenport on the Disney XD series "Lab Rats."
